One Bit Full Adder Design Using Basic Gates | (Bangla Tutorial)
In this video,we will learn how to design One Bit Full Adder circuit.To simplify the circuit's expression we have used 3-variable k-map.Finally,we have designed the circuit using basic gates.Hope this will be helpful to you!
